- Glendale, AZ, USA

I ordered from Robert Love on IG supplements of Lions Mane and Aniracetam. I payed $350 as it was supposed to be really good and special for preventing Alzheimers. A week later I get request from the shipping company QWKLogistics that my package was held up at Maricopa County Sheriffs office as it was illegal psychedelics and I needed to pay $400 to email [email protected]. It actually turned out to be $416.99 as it was changed into Euros!. Robert Love kept pleading with me to pay the $400 and he would reimburse me on the weekend when he has funds again. He also claimed that he never had any issues with the company and yes, of course it was illegal psychedelics. Upon asking why I was not informed as I do not use psychedelics I never got an answer. At some point many hrs of communicating w Robert Love on IG i received an email from the OWKLogistic company that they wanted me to pay $400 to another email as the first one was too difficult to get the money out! Robert Love kept on pleading to please help me as he had payed for other customers and had no more funds left to pay for mine! Now he knew it happened before, and he got nasty, that if I do no help, I end up with years in jail as I after all ordered illegal psychedelics! At that point I refused to pay any further money.(I have screenshots of most of the conversation as he deleted the old account and I have chat and email with OWKLogistics that they refunded me the $400, which they did, insisting that I needed to pay it to another personal account via paypal friends and family (found out its difficult to get money back using friends and family). He was all day harassing me and the OWKLogistic as well, now with a special supervisor for me to pay the money. I also called the Sheriffs department and they did not know anything and said that I needed to have a case number which I do not have. Its definitely a scam and I do not like that they sell or say they sell without disclosing it illegal psychedelics! Robert Love kept on promising that he would return all the money to me over the weekend. Having him caught in several lies, I do not believe that at all. I am out right now $350 a lot of heartache and hrs and hrs of dealing with them. I really feel they both need to be investigated.

- Springville, CA, USA

I saw an ad for Amazx thinking this was the Amazon outlet. They promised a box of "items" that were returned to what I thought was Amazon. On Christmas Eve, I received a sealed box in a mystery box that contained some unknown earplugs with a charger. I contacted the company when I discovered that the company was bogus asking to cancel my order. They said I couldn't. They said the "items" will be sent individually over time. When I told them I thought they were a fraud, they offered me a "discount" of 15%. When I said no, they offered me 25%. That's when I decided to report them as fraud.

The "company" used an amazon looking logo in their ad with a video of a warehouse of "returned" items. Each item they presented was an actual named brand item and the box was supposed to be a "large" box with many returned items. I was taken, and I hope nobody else will be taken.
